Over the years, companies in the gaming sector and beyond have made the commitment to do better when it comes to pushing for diversity, equity and inclusion (DEI). Leveling up on those promises takes the entire industry and everyone in the room. Join us in a conversation with Patty Dingle, Riot Games, Laura Waniuk, Bad Robot Games, Ekta Chopra, e.l.f. Beauty and Jenn Panattoni, Xbox, who are leaders equipping their organizations and teams to drive change inside and out. We'll hear about initiatives that have been created to level the playing field for women and support broader DEI priorities. We'll discuss what has worked and those that didn't quite land and what everyone can do to be an agent for change, no matter how small the action.

Takeaway

From this panel discussion, attendees will get a deeper understanding of the unique challenges women face in gaming, learn from initiatives that have set out to address women in gaming and DEI challenges, and get inspired to help drive change.

Intended Audience

This is for anyone who wants to support diversity, equity and inclusion in the gaming industry.
